problem in Excel's VB Help
 
I have a user that when he opens the VB Editor Help in either Excel or Word,
he cannot do any searches as his cursor changes to a horizontal double arrow
in the input fields. I've only found 2 mentions of this on the net... one
said this happens if the app is launched through IE, kill msohelp process,
but not the case here... the other was a posting on a usergroup that was
never answered. I've done a detect and repair and tried Excel in safe mode.
ideas?

Bob Phillips

problem in Excel's VB Help
 
I get this quite regularly, and I don't run IE. This indicates with the help
process though.

Go to the task manager (Ctrl-Alt-Del), select the processes tab, then select
MSOHELP.exe in the list. Hit the End Process button.

Back in VBIDE restart help, it should be okay tyhen.
